To create a channel, you must specify the
Channel Name and TransceiverID properties.

TransceiverId
Y Y An
enumerated value indicating the channel
type. The ID attribute is the transceiver ID as
reported by LNS. The value is the transceiver
name as determined in the StdXcvr.XML file.
The possible values are as follows:
